Procedural Posture

Miscellaneous Civil Application / Ruling on Application for Extension of Time

  1. 1 Whether the applicant has shown sufficient cause for extension of time to file a reference application against the ruling of the District Land and Housing Tribunal

Ratio Decidendi

The applicant acted diligently by requesting the ruling promptly and filing the application soon after obtaining it. The delay was justified by the late supply of the ruling due to the tribunal's defective printer. Sufficient cause for the delay was established, warranting the exercise of the court's discretion to extend time.

Court Disposition

Application granted

Orders

  • Applicant to file reference application within 14 days from the date of this ruling
  • No order as to costs
